Erika Bók is a highly acclaimed Hungarian actress, renowned for her captivating performances in a diverse range of cinematic masterpieces.
One of her most notable roles is in the critically acclaimed film "The Turin Horse" (2011),a thought-provoking and visually stunning work that explores the complexities of human existence.
In addition to her work in "The Turin Horse", Bók has also made a lasting impression in "The Man from London" (2007),a gripping and suspenseful thriller that showcases her remarkable acting abilities.
Furthermore, her portrayal of a character in the groundbreaking and avant-garde film "Satantango" (1994) has earned her widespread recognition and acclaim within the film industry.
Throughout her illustrious career, Erika Bók has consistently demonstrated her remarkable talent and versatility as an actress, leaving a lasting impact on the world of cinema.
